Choosing a Single Stroller for Sale

A stroller is among the most expensive baby purchases new parents will make. The stroller is among the most popular items on baby registry lists, so it's crucial to choose the right one.

There are a variety of factors to consider, including: weight and portability, convenience, safety and ease of use. Check out this article for information and tips on choosing the best single stroller available for sale.

Lightweight

A single stroller for sale that is lightweight and easy to move will help you save lots of time on your daily walks. The models featured on this list are ideal for busy parents as they come with handy storage options for baby bags, shopping bags and snacks. Many also include a reliable break system and sturdy wheels for safe, comfortable strolling. Some have a bassinet designed for newborns and babies.

If you're looking for a light, simple travel stroller, this option from Babyzen is a good choice. It's narrower than other strollers, making it easier to maneuver through crowds in city streets. It folds into a small package that can fit in your car trunk or in the overhead bin of a plane. It's a great option for people who live in urban areas or who plan to travel often with their children.

The Contours Itsy is another lightweight stroller that's perfect for travel. This model has tri-folding that is unique and makes it smaller than other strollers. It is also very easy to assemble with only a few clicks. It's also a simple stroller, which means you won't find any extras like cup holders or oversized baskets that weigh it down or take up space.

Nuna TRVL is another option for a light stroller that is ideal for trips with toddlers. The stroller isn't as compact as the Babyzen YOYO2 or Munchkin Sparrow, but it is still able to fold into a compact size that's easy to carry and store. The stroller also features a large storage bin under the seat and an adjustable handle that can be used when folded.

This stroller has one downside It's not as sturdy as some of the others on this list. Families who are planning to gate-check the stroller on flights should steer clear of it, as baggage handlers could snap the footrest. Its padded handlebar isn't adjustable and therefore it won't be the best choice for parents who are taller.

Easy to move

Whether you're headed to an urban area for some time off or an easy stroll around the neighborhood, you need a stroller that's easy to move. The best strollers for traveling are light and compact and are therefore easier to transport on trains, planes, or in cars. They are smaller and less bulky, which is great for those who live in tiny apartments or have little storage space. These models are ideal for urban parents since they're designed to be able to navigate busy streets and narrow sidewalks.

The Babyzen Yoyo+ stroller is a great choice for travelers because it is lightweight and small enough to fit into most trunks. It's also narrower than other strollers, making it easier to maneuver through crowds on sidewalks. It has a lot to offer despite its tiny size, including a large storage basket under the seat, a five-point harness, a recliner, and a sunshade that can cover the heads of children (although, we wish the canopy was more angled). It also comes with a bag to store travel and car seat adapters for Nuna Pipa/MaxiCosi/Cybex and UPPAbaby Mesa infant carseats. The only downside is that the handlebar is a little high and isn't adjustable, which may be an issue for some shorter adults.

The Munchkin Sparrow stroller is a compact, lightweight option that is ideal for travel. It's ideal for families who do not want to pay for luggage fees and can pack the stroller in a moments notice. It's easy to maneuver and comes with a built-in cup holder and storage tray. It's more expensive than the Babyzen Yoyo+ but offers more features, such as an adjustable handlebar, a reclined seat and a padded bumper bar.

Choosing the right single stroller with standing board stroller for your child's travels will depend on your child's age and requirements. If your child is a newborn and you need a travel system which integrates with a car seat. If they're a toddler, you'll require a compact, lightweight stroller that can make sharp turns and go over bumps.

Convenient storage

If you're in the market for one stroller, you'll need to make sure that it has plenty of storage space for your baby's snacks and toys. This will allow you to keep everything neat and organized so that in the event of an emergency, you can locate it quickly. Many strollers come with convenient storage options which make it simple to keep your child’s essentials close by. Storage options include a tray for the parent or canopy, stow pocket, and an under-seat basket.

If you have limited space or just need a stroller for occasional use, you can opt for a single jogging stroller stroller that is light. These strollers are generally easier to fold and are compact enough to take on your next trip or to take a short trip to the grocery store. They are usually less expensive than full-size strollers and are more durable than umbrellas.

Another option is a stroller that's easy to assemble and has ample storage. This kind of stroller single is easy to assemble in a few clicks of buttons. The Itsy has a spacious cargo area as well as a cupholder for the parent, however it doesn't come with an over-sized basket like other strollers. It has a raincover, as well as a handlebar bag that can accommodate snacks and other items.

Some strollers can serve many purposes, and they are especially useful for parents who live in urban areas or have limited car storage. A stroller with a jogger, for instance, can be used to complete through the park. A convertible stroller is, however, is ideal for daily strolls around the neighborhood.

If you're a frequent traveler, you'll require a single stroller that is able to fit into the overhead bin of an plane. You'll also want to consider the stroller's durability and comfort, as well as compatibility with car seats. Some strollers have adaptors for car seats built-in and some need to be purchased separately. Double strollers should come with a large cargo area, a reclining chair, and a safety belt.

Safety

A great stroller will ensure that your child's stroll is a fun and peaceful experience. It should have good brakes, be free of parts that can pinch a kid's fingers or pose a choking danger, and have robust handles. It should also have a wide wheel base, and be stable enough to ensure that the seat is kept low within the frame. It should also have a good canopy, as well as convenient storage areas.

Strollers for children must comply with strict safety standards set by the Consumer Product Safety Commission. These include safe hinges, wheel locks and seat belts. Some strollers sold by importers and retailers may not meet these requirements. It is important to check the stroller you're thinking of buying thoroughly before buying it.

The best single stroller for sale is one that is easy to maneuver and comfortable for parents. You should look for a stroller that can fold in one hand and fits in your car's trunk. It should also come with tires made of foam that don't collapse easily and can take rough terrain without hassle. You should also choose strollers that lock front wheels. This will help you navigate narrow walkways and curbs with ease.

It's important to choose a stroller that is designed specifically for your child's age weight, and height. The newborns must be able to lie almost completely flat, and toddlers need to be able to sit up in the seat with their head held. Also, you should look for a safe restraining system that features straps for the shoulders and a waist strap and a hand rest that is adjustable.

While you're shopping for a stroller make sure to take into account your budget. If you want to save money, shop at discount stores or purchase used. Register your stroller at the manufacturer. This will ensure you receive any recall notices promptly.
